At the heart of Shia teachings lies the concept of Tawhid, the absolute oneness of God. This foundational principle underscores the profound belief that only Allah possesses the sovereign authority to grant requests articulated through Duas. Consequently, the potency of these supplications is intrinsically linked to an individual’s understanding of divine attributes. When one beseeches the Creator, it is critical to approach with a heart full of sincerity, humility, and confidence in God’s mercy.

Within Shia Islam, there exists an extensive array of Duas, each tailored for specific occasions or spiritual needs. These prayers may be recited individually or collectively, thereby fostering a communal sense of faith. For instance, the renowned Dua al-Qunoot is frequently recited during obligatory prayers, embodying a plea for guidance and righteousness. Likewise, the Dua of Kumayl stands as a beacon of hope during nights of personal supplication, conveying a yearning for forgiveness and the alleviation of life’s tribulations.

Another notable aspect of Shia teachings is the emphasis on the timing and circumstances surrounding the recitation of Duas. Certain moments are considered auspicious, such as the nights of Ramadan, Fridays, and the hours preceding dawn. It is believed that during these intervals, the likelihood of prayers being answered is significantly heightened. Hence, adept practitioners often seek to align their supplications with these spiritually fortuitous moments.
